While the state of the art is relatively sophisticated in programming language support for computer algebra, there has been less development in programming language support for symbolic computation over the past two decades. We summarize certain advances in programming languages for computer algebra and propose a set of directions and challenges for programming languages for symbolic computation.

By means of the extended homoclinic test approach (shortly EHTA) with the aid of a symbolic computation system such as Maple, some complexiton type solutions for the (3+1)-dimensional Jimbo-Miwa equation are presented.
